In all honesty, it depends on how fast you are playing and how bright of sound you are looking for from each stroke.
I personally use Dunlop .60mm vinyl picks, which are much more flimsy than many bassists use, but I find it allows me to move around the strings much easier while still keeping a good bright sound.
If you want something that really cuts through, you may look as large as 1mm picks, but for me those always seem to hang up on the strings and slow me down.
Just my two cents.

I haven't played professionally since the Regan administration, but back in the day I was in a lot of cover bands so I had to change up styles and tone pretty often. I ended up splitting about 50/50 between fingers and Ernie Ball thumb picks (designed for banjo and mandolin) which I wore all the time so I could switch easily. I don't know what gauge they were but it seemed like they were roughly equivalent to a fender medium. They were a lot stiffer though because the pick point is fairly short. I also installed a thumb rest above the strings and about midway between pickups on every bass I ever owned so I had a point of reference when I was fingering. But to answer your question I use Dunlop Tortex 1.14mm (the purple ones). I used to use thinner picks but I find that I'm more articulate if I use a heavier pick. Plus you can lay into it more. For guitar I used to use really thin picks (.50mm) but for the past 5 years or so I've just been using the same for both. Probably just out of laziness but I have found that it forces me to be more articulate there again.
